UK casino payment methods: compare deposits and withdrawals separately

Compare casino payment methods by deposit support, withdrawal routes, account ownership, fees, limits and verification instead of judging the cashier by deposit speed alone.

A payment option that works well for deposits is not automatically the best route for withdrawals. A useful casino comparison looks at both directions of the cashier and treats them as separate workflows.

Check deposit support first

Confirm which methods are available for funding the account, the minimum amount and whether the payment appears immediately or after a short processing stage.

Then check the withdrawal route

Some deposit methods cannot receive withdrawals. The casino may use a different route for cashing out, so review the withdrawal options before making the first deposit.

Account ownership matters

The name on the bank account, card or e-wallet may need to match the casino account. Differences can trigger additional checks or make a payment route unavailable.

Compare limits in both directions

Minimum deposits, minimum withdrawals and transaction caps can be different. A method may be convenient for small deposits but unsuitable for a larger withdrawal.

Separate casino fees from provider fees

The operator may charge no fee while a bank, wallet or currency conversion still creates a cost. Compare the total transaction rather than only the casino's own fee line.

Verification can be method-specific

A casino may need evidence that a payment method belongs to the account holder. Check how that process works and whether documents can be uploaded securely.

Deposit speed does not predict payout speed

Instant account funding says nothing about the operator's withdrawal review or the final transfer time. Compare those stages separately.

Keep transaction history visible

A good cashier makes it easy to see deposits, withdrawals, statuses, timestamps and transaction references in one place.

Conclusion

Compare payment methods as two flows: money in and money out. Method support, ownership, limits, fees, verification and final transfer time all matter.
